Urban hiking trails in De Veaux Woods State Park are characterized by a blend of old-growth forests and open meadows, situated within the greater Niagara Falls region. The park features a 51-acre ancient woodland with oak trees, some over 300 years old, alongside varied flora and fauna. Its geological position provides access to the Niagara Gorge and views of the Niagara River. The terrain includes gentle woodland paths and connections to more extensive trail systems along the river.

The American Falls are the second-largest of the three falls, separated from the much larger Horseshoe Falls by Goat Island. The third, smaller waterfall is the Bridal Veil Falls, which is next to the American Falls and separated by Luna Island.

What makes urban hiking in De Veaux Woods State Park unique?

The park is home to a rare 51-acre old-growth forest with oak trees over 300 years old, providing a unique natural sanctuary within an urban setting. Hikers can enjoy varied scenery, from historic woodlands and open meadows to dramatic views of the Niagara River and its gorge, often with the Niagara Falls skyline in the distance.

Can I bring my dog on the urban hiking trails in De Veaux Woods State Park?

Yes, De Veaux Woods State Park is generally dog-friendly. The park even features a dedicated dog park. Most trails within the park and connecting to the Niagara Gorge Trail System allow leashed dogs, making it a great place to explore with your canine companion.

What is the best time of year to go urban hiking in De Veaux Woods State Park?

The park is enjoyable year-round. Warmer months are ideal for hiking and biking, with lush greenery and vibrant wildflowers. In winter, the landscape transforms, offering opportunities for cross-country skiing and ice skating. The old-growth forest provides beautiful scenery in all seasons.

What amenities are available at De Veaux Woods State Park for hikers?

De Veaux Woods State Park offers several amenities to enhance your visit. You'll find scenic picnicking areas, large open meadows, and a modern playground for families. The park also provides ball diamonds and a dog park. Entry and parking are free, making it an accessible option for a day outdoors.
